Production credits:
  • Special visual effects, Albert Whitlock ; special effects, Roy Arbogast ; music, Ennio Morricone ; photography, Dean Cundey ; special make-up effects, Rob Bottin ; executive producer, Wilbur Stark ; editor, Todd Ramsey ; production design, John L. Lloyd.
Cast: Kurt Russell, Wilford Brimley, T.K. Carter, David Clennon, Keith David, Richard Dysart, Charles Hallahan, Peter Maloney, Richard Masur, Donald Moffat, Joel Polis, Thomas Waites.Summary: Set in the winter of 1982 at a research station in Antarctica, a twelve man research team finds an alien being that has fallen from the sky and has remained buried in the snow for over 100,000 years. Unfrozen and unleashed, the THING creates havoc and terror as it changes forms and becomes one of them.
